Regardless of the time of year, saving money on your purchases is always a big deal. And that is exactly what specific shopping sites have in mind for their customers.
“Two years ago, people used them for electronics and computer gear. These days, shoppers are using them for every kind of product you can imagine,” said Bill Tancer, general manager of global research for Hitwise, an Internet-traffic monitoring company.
Tancer added that people are using sites like Nextag.com, Pricegrabber.com and Shopzilla.com to get the best prices for everything from cashmere sweaters to toasters. Traffic to major comparison sites last week was 24% higher than a year ago, an indicator that online shopping has become a mainstream activity. [Read the rest]
